Nitrobenzene, C6​H5​NO2​, an important raw material for the dye industry, is prepared from benzene, C6​H6​ (molar weight 78.1 g/mol ), and nitric acid, HNOO3​ according to the following chemical equation: C6​H6​(l)+HNO3​(l)→C6​H5​NO2​(l)+H2​O(l) a. When 22.4 g of benzene and an excess of nitric acid are used, what is the theoretical yieid of nitrobenzene (molar weight 123.1 g/mol )? Theoretical yield = 9 b. If 32.0 g of nitrobenzene is recovered, what is the percentage yield? Percentage yield =
